Locked Up | Amygdala | |
|---|---|---|
| Released | 2020 | 2024 |
| Genres | Indie | Indie, Adventure |
| Platforms | Windows | Windows |
| Steam Deck | Deck Playable | Deck Unsupported |
| Price | 12.99 USD | 6.66 USD |
| Steam reviews | 78.5% positive (633 reviews) | 75.4% positive (122 reviews) |
| Multiplayer | Single-player only | Single-player only |
| Developers | EMIKA_GAMES | Stigma Studios |
